Flight radar 24 uses ADS Transponder technology to track airplanes so only those aircrafts are visible on it which are equipped with ADS.

In case of PAF all of its transport aircrafts are equipped with it as they have much interaction with civil airspace(but also appear when landing at PAF bases such as Mushaf) though in some cases they turn it off e.g c130s operating at TCS,Pindi.Dassault Falcon is also sometimes seen on FR24 so spotting a UAV isnt something special.

As far as fighters are concerned,they never appear on FR24 but u can hear the comms at Liveatc if u get lucky.

Also naval ATRs are also visible on FR24.
Even PAAs helis are sometimes visible.

Never, except a few exhange cadets getting a chance.
They are not exchange cadets but sent on a deputation course there either as students, and sometimes there are instructor pilots who fly at the Central Flying School on Tucanos. RAF aviation cadets do not attend PAF Academy for flight training hence no concept of exchange cadets.
